The side effects of teeth whitening are minimal and typically only last a few days. Using whitening treatments too frequently can increase your risk of developing tooth sensitivity and gum irritation. You can help reduce your risk of developing side effects from teeth whitening treatments by using products responsibly and as directed. If you experience gum irritation, redness, or pain, stop using teeth whitening treatments until your gums are fully healed or otherwise directed by your dentist.
